Question 1182312: A man, 1.5m tall, is on top of the building. He observes a car on the road at an angle of 75°. If the buildibg is 30m high, how far is the car from the building?

How do you mean that angle? Of depression, or do you mean from base of building to man's eyes to the car?


If it is not angle of depression then, for distance from building to the car, man's eyes 31.5 meters, x=31.5tan%2875%29
